Batelco is working relentlessly to provide the highest level of quality performance towards maintaining ISO9001:2000 accreditation.
Within this context, the globally recognised quality assurance body, the British Standards Institute (BSI) concluded a four-day assessment visit to a number of Batelco departments.
"The BSI closely audited a number of departments and specific functions ranging from order processing and billing to network operation," explained Batelco corporate affairs general manager Ahmed Al Janahi.
"We are proud of the fact that the BSI has re-confirmed that all the assessed areas and processes still meet ISO 9001:2000 standards."
During the four-day visit the BSI auditing team assessed two large scale business services - MPLS (Multi-Protocol Label Switching) and SDH (Synchronised Digital Hierarchy) and also the Mystery Shopper process at Batelco's retail shops.
